Expert Analysis

What Makes It Unique

A historical abstraction of gardenia, which cannot be distilled naturally, rendered using tuberose and synthetic greens.

Pakistan & GCC Perspective

Its light, clean soapiness is incredibly elegant and doesn't cloy, even in warm humid South Asian coastal regions.

How It Compares

More vintage, powdery, and abstract than Estee Lauder's hyper-realistic Private Collection Tuberose Gardenia.

The Controversy

Despite the name, many critics state it smells far more like a sweet tuberose/jasmine blend than a realistic, earthy gardenia.

Gardenia Notes Breakdown

Gardenia opens with Orange Blossom and Green Notes — the first impression as it hits the skin. As the opening settles, the composition pivots to its heart of Gardenia, Tuberose, Jasmine and Fruity Notes. The final act — the part that outlasts the working day — is Coconut, Vanilla, Musk, Sandalwood and Patchouli.

Strip it back to the bones and the profile reads White Floral, Green, Sweet, Fruity — the kind of profile that rewards a second and third wearing.

How It Performs: The Numbers

Longevity (7/10): Gardenia delivers strong longevity for EDT. On most skin types expect 5–8 hours. A midday touch-up is rarely necessary but can extend the experience on special occasions.

Sillage (6/10): Gardenia projects at a social distance, noticeable without overwhelming. Application to pulse points — wrists, neck, and behind the ears — maximises projection without overwhelming the room.

Versatility (8/10): Gardenia is a genuine all-rounder — at ease at a wedding, a boardroom meeting, or a late-night dinner. From casual daytime to formal evening, it adapts without feeling out of place.

Value (6/10): Pricing at around $300 feels appropriate for what you get — neither a bargain nor an overreach.
